    The World's Mightiest Boy!

    Just received Capt. Marvel Jr. today:

    image.jpg

    image.jpg

    FTC really hit a homerun with this one: head is well-sculpted and in scale, the suit is well-tailored and fits great. This figure looks great alongside Mego, Mattel or FTC Captain Marvel and I couldn't be happier with him---great improvement over the prototype pics. Fingers crossed that the Superboy final product turns out as nice!
